The Quellbrook partner SFTP drop is where Hartwing Logistics lands their nightly manifests. Our poller checks the drop every fifteen minutes and forwards new files to the ingest queue — you don't need to touch the SFTP box directly. To talk to the poller's status endpoint (handy for checking stuck files), you authenticate against the internal Quellbrook API with the following key.

app token of yagaf-bahop = vxb2-4d

## Deployment

Quick notes for the sync: the Scanlark barcode integration now ships as its own sidecar, so you don't need the old udev hacks anymore. Deploys go through the standard Bramble pipeline — push to release, wait for the smoke test against the handheld fleet in the Oakhollow warehouse, then promote. One gotcha: the scanner daemon reads its settings at boot only. The values it needs are the following:

settings of fafog-haduf:
ZORIX_PIN=4648
ZORIX_METRICS_HOST=metrics.zorix.paliqsys.corp
ZORIX_LOG_LEVEL=info
ZORIX_TENANT=druix

## Ownership

Pagination in the Quillgate public REST API is cursor-based, and yes, the opaque cursor format is on purpose — don't try to make it "nicer," clients will start parsing it and we'll never be able to change it again. Future maintainers: the cursor encoder lives in `pager/`, and the backwards-compat tests are sacred. Breaking changes need a deprecation window of two releases. If you're unsure whether a change counts as breaking, ask the current owner, named below.

account owner for bawip-tahag: Raleth Quenok

Management Meeting Minutes — Legacy Pricing

Attendees agreed the legacy tier for Quillbase customers is underpriced versus cost to serve. Finance will model a staged 8% increase starting next renewal cycle, with grandfathering for multi-year contracts. Tomas will draft customer comms; Priya owns the churn estimate. Context for the decision is noted confidentially below.

management briefing: Project Ulavan slips by two quarters because of the staffing delay.